I don't like to keep picking on your posts Doloras because you are not the only one commenting on this stuff from your angle, but again this just smacks of an ill conceived conspiracy theory.
 
How about a really simple explanation. 
 
Terry owed lots of people money.  People start bankruptcy proceedings to get that money back.  The media find out about it and started reporting it. 
 
John Morrison (Councillor for sport) doesn't want the local sports franchise to go bust, having it in town is a good thing for the council and the city.  Speaks to a few people in town who have a bit of cash, and is contacted by others.  Starts to put a backup plan in place
 
Terry still owes people money.  More and people try to recover that money as he is clearly in trouble and may struggle to pay everyone back.
 
Phoenix stop paying some of their bills, including players and staff.  Other staff let go and not replaced.  More evidence Terry will struggle to pay everyone back and fund the club.  People become more concerned about the future of the club, back up plan accelerated.  Media report it.
 
Terry is going bust all by himself - he doesn't need anyone's help, whether from the media or otherwise.
 
Lender's are not trying to take revenge, they just want their money back.  If they wanted him bankrupt they would have done it months ago.
 
Morrison's agenda seems to be to keep the club afloat and in Wellington.  Good on him.
 
There are a few leaks about - no surprise there.  But it hardly a pile of info, we know next to nothing about what is going on, and what we do is a very incomplete picture.
